This is a 4-step calibration block manufactured from stainless steel, designed for use in ultrasonic testing (UT). It's used to calibrate UT thickness gauges and verify the linearity of the equipment's response across a range of thicknesses. The block consists of four distinct steps, each precisely machined to specific thicknesses: 0.25 inches, 0.50 inches, 0.75 inches, and 1.00 inch.
The stainless steel construction ensures durability, corrosion resistance, and consistent acoustic properties. The block is supplied with a protective case for safe storage and transport.
